NCT ID: NCT01893476 Completed - Clinical trials for Chronic Obstructive Pulmonary Disease (COPD)

A Pragmatic Cluster Trial of a Tailored Intervention to Improve COPD Management

TICD-COPD
Start date: September 2013
Phase: N/A
Study type: Interventional

Background: Chronic Obstructive Pulmonary Disease (COPD) remains a major health problem, which is strongly related to smoking. Despite publication of guidelines on the prevention and treatment of COPD, not all COPD patients receive the best available healthcare. Investigators developed a tailored implementation strategy for improving primary care physicians' adherence to COPD management guidelines. The primary aim of the presented trial is to evaluate the effects of this strategy on physician's performance. The secondary aim is to examine the validity of the tailoring of implementation interventions. Primary Trial Hypothesis: To study if the rate of adherence to the COPD guideline over a 1 year will increase among participants assigned to the intervention group in comparison to those assigned to the control group? Methods/Design: A two-arm pragmatic cluster randomized trial is planned. A total of 540 patients with diagnosed COPD will be included from 18 general practices in Poland. A tailored implementation program will be offered to general practitioners. Participating physicians in the intervention practices (n=18) will receive training to provide brief anti-smoking counselling. An additional form containing COPD severity scale will be inserted into patient's medical records. The checklist with key information about the disease and its management while consulting a patient with COPD will be provided to practitioners. Investigators will provide practices with training inhaler devices for general practitioners (GPs) to teach patients in correct use of each device and to note this education/training in patient's medical records. The control practices will provide usual care. Discussion: The results of this trial will be directly applicable to primary care in Poland and add to the growing body of evidence on interventions to improve chronic illness care.

NCT ID: NCT01892488 Completed - Clinical trials for Chronic Obstructive Pulmonary Disease (COPD)

Study to Demonstrate That Antibiotics Are Not Needed in Moderate Acute Exacerbations of COPD

Start date: June 7, 2013
Phase: Phase 4
Study type: Interventional

The ultimate goal is to reduce unnecessary antibiotic prescriptions which drive the development of antibiotic resistance in the community. The primary objective of ABACOPD is to demonstrate in a sufficiently sized clinical study that there is no relevant increase in the "failure-rate" for patients with acute moderate exacerbations of COPD (AE-COPD) treated with placebo instead of antibiotic treatment both on top of standard of care. A patient is classified as treatment failure if additional antibiotic therapy is required during treatment period or until the test of cure visit (TOC at day 30, primary endpoint).

NCT ID: NCT01880177 Completed - Clinical trials for Chronic Obstructive Pulmonary Disease (COPD)

Developing a COPD Case Finding Methodology for Primary Care

Start date: February 2013
Phase: N/A
Study type: Observational

The purpose of this qualitative work is to inform the content and structure of a new screening measure for identifying undiagnosed at-risk COPD cases in primary care and support content validity of the measure. This work will build on the results of a comprehensive literature review and data mining analyses by identifying the symptomatic and health event experiences of at-risk and newly diagnosed patients, as described by the patients themselves. Specific objectives are as follows: Objective 1: To elicit concepts and symptom descriptions of COPD from patients with a recent diagnosis of COPD and those without a diagnosis but with risk factors for the disease. The qualitative information obtained in these focus groups will be used to develop a new questionnaire for identifying undiagnosed at-risk COPD cases in various clinic settings. Objective 2: To review the new questionnaire with a new set of participants with a recent COPD diagnosis or those at risk for COPD to ensure that: (a) the instructions are clear, (b) the content of each question is appropriate and understandable to participants, (c) the intended connotation of each questions is consistent with participants' interpretation or assigned meaning, and (d) to assure that content is not seen as redundant across items. This will be done through one-on-one cognitive interviews. Objective 3: To gather data on the ease/difficulty of peak flow meter use by people without or with a new diagnosis of COPD and the consistency of readings between electronic and mechanical readings in these patients. This information will be used to inform the development of peak-flow meter instructions for use as part of the screening methodology.

NCT ID: NCT01879410 Completed - Clinical trials for Pulmonary Disease, Chronic Obstructive

A Study to Compare the Efficacy and Safety of Umeclidinium/Vilanterol With Fluticasone Propionate/Salmeterol in Subjects With Chronic Obstructive Pulmonary Disease (COPD)

Start date: June 13, 2013
Phase: Phase 3
Study type: Interventional

Umeclidinium/vilanterol (UMEC/VI) is a combination product under development that is used for the treatment of airflow obstruction in patients with COPD. Fluticasone propionate/salmeterol (FSC) is an approved drug that is already in use for the treatment of COPD. This is a multicenter, randomized, double-blind, double-dummy, parallel group study to evaluate the efficacy and safety of UMEC/VI 62.5/25 microgram [mcg] once daily administered via Novel Dry Powder Inhaler (NDPI) compared with fluticasone propionate /salmeterol (FSC) 250/50 mcg twice-daily when administered via ACCUHALER/DISKUS inhaler over a treatment period of 12 weeks in subjects with COPD. Eligible subjects will be equally randomized to UMEC/VI 62.5/25 mcg or FSC 250/50 mcg for 12 weeks. A safety follow-up assessment will be conducted approximately 7 days after the end of the study treatment.

NCT ID: NCT01871025 Completed - Clinical trials for Chronic Obstructive Pulmonary Disease

Early Incentive and Mobilization During COPD Exacerbation

TIME
Start date: December 2013
Phase: N/A
Study type: Interventional

To study the effects of early exercise training in hospitalized patients for Chronic Obstructive Pulmonary Disease exacerbation (COPD). Interventions are randomized. In one group, early exercise training (aerobic and strength) during hospitalization for COPD exacerbation followed by exercise training at home until 30 days to discharge and in the other the intervention is usual care. In both groups, usual respiratory physiotherapy techniques during hospitalization and adequate physical activity recommendations have been included. The main variable is the increase in moderate or vigorous daily physical activities at 30 days after discharge.

NCT ID: NCT01868009 Completed - Clinical trials for Pulmonary Disease, Chronic Obstructive

DISKUS vs. ELLIPTA Device Preference Study in Chronic Obstructive Pulmonary Disease (COPD)

Start date: May 2013
Phase: Phase 3
Study type: Interventional

Subjects who have not used the ELLIPTA™ inhaler nor the DISKUS™ inhaler in the past 6 months will be screened to participate in the study. Subjects will have an equal chance of being in any of the following two groups (1:1 allocation). One group will be dispensed the ELLIPTA inhaler at Visit 1 to use during the first period (once daily for 5 to9 days), and the DISKUS inhaler at Visit 2 to use during the second period (twice daily for 5 to 9 days). The other group will be dispensed the DISKUS inhaler at Visit 1 to use during the first period (twice daily for 5 to 9 days), and the ELLIPTA inhaler at Visit 2 to use during the second period (once daily for 5 to9 days). At the end of the second period, subjects will complete the study by answering 7 questions to assess their preference of device attributes and dosing regimens between the two inhalers. The null hypothesis for device preference for a specific attribute is that 50% subjects express a preference in that attribute for ELLIPTA and 50% do NOT express a preference in that attribute for ELLIPTA, i.e., the odds for preferring ELLIPTA to not preferring ELLIPTA is unity. The null hypothesis for dosing regimen preference is that 50% subjects express a preference of once daily dosing and 50% do not express a preference of once daily dosing (prefer twice daily dosing or have no preference).

NCT ID: NCT01867970 Completed - Type 2 Diabetes Clinical Trials

Interactive Tool to Support Self-management Through Lifestyle Feedback, Aimed at Physical Activity of COPD/DM Patients

RCTIt'sLiFe!
Start date: April 2013
Phase: N/A
Study type: Interventional

Rationale: Physical activity is an important factor for a healthy lifestyle. Although physical activity can delay complications and decrease the burden of the disease in chronically ill persons, their level of activity is often far from optimal. Many interventions have been developed to stimulate physical activity, with disappointing results. New in this field is the use of technology. Human persuasion (for example guidance by a practice nurse) can be enhanced by technological persuasion. Therefore a monitor and feedback tool, consisting of an accelerometer linked to a smart phone and webserver, has been developed and tested. Objective: The main objective of this study is to measure the effects of the monitoring and feedback tool embedded in a Self-management Support Program on physical activity. The secondary objective is to measure the effect on self-efficacy, quality of life and health status. In addition a process evaluation will be conducted. Study design: A three-armed cluster randomised controlled trial will be conducted with 240 patients from 24 general practices. Randomisation level is the practice. The following conditions will be compared: 1) Tool and Self-management Support Program; 2) Self-management Support Program; 3) Care as usual. Outcome measures will be measured at t0 (before the start of the intervention), t1 (after 6 months, at the end of the intervention) and t2 (after 9 months). Study population: 120 People with COPD and 120 people with Diabetes type 2 (aged 40-70) treated in primary care will be included from 24 GP practices. Intervention: Spread over a period of six months patients in condition 1 and 2 have to visit the practice nurse for 3-4 times for physical activity counselling. Specific activity goals will be set that are tailored to the individual patient's preferences and needs. On top of this, patients in condition 1 will be instructed to use the monitoring and feedback tool in daily life. Patients in condition 3 will not be exposed to any intervention. Main study parameters/endpoints: Primary outcome: physical activity measured with a physical activity monitor (PAM). Secondary outcomes: quality of life, general self-efficacy, exercise self-efficacy and health status.
